Technical field
The present invention relates to bridge field, specifically a kind of bridge maintaining equipment.
Background technology
Mud is most commonly seen one of raw material during bridge pavement is safeguarded, mainly by cement, sandstone water mixing stirring after It is made, the pouring for being mainly used for hogwallow after bridge pavement damages is filled up, for the stirring in mud manufacturing process in tradition Typically using artificial stirring, whipping process is time-consuming and laborious and inefficiency so that safeguards that progress is slow, also has in existing More automation mud agitating device, but its use cost is high, and complicated for operation and mixing direction is single so that stirring raw material pole It is uneven, leverages construction quality, therefore existing agitating device needs to improve there are larger drawback.
